Answer-first:

Pet-friendly living in Saigon centers on Thảo Điền (D2) and Phú Mỹ Hưng (D7). Condos like Estella Heights and City Garden allow dogs and cats under 15kg, while towers like Masteri enforce service elevator rules. Leases require a written pet addendum, a 0.5–1 month pet deposit, and mandatory rabies vaccination certificates.

Relocating to Ho Chi Minh City with domestic dogs, cats, or small animals requires careful property screening. While Vietnamese urban culture has become enthusiastically pet-friendly over the past decade, high-density residential towers enforce strict internal regulations (Nội quy quản lý nhà chung cư) governed by independent Building Management Boards (Ban Quản Lý).

In Vietnam’s legal landscape, an individual private landlord’s verbal approval is legally subordinate to the building’s official charter. Moving a pet into a condominium that maintains a strict “No Pets Allowed” rule will result in administrative warnings, suspension of resident elevator access badges, or forced premature lease termination.

1. 2026 Saigon Condo Pet Policy Matrix & Building Index

Pet policies vary significantly across major condominium developments in Ho Chi Minh City. Based on verified 2026 building management charters across expatriate corridors, here is the official pet policy matrix:

Condominium DevelopmentDistrict & Micro-LocationPet Status & Weight ThresholdDesignated Green Zones & Dog RunsElevator ProtocolPet Friendliness Rating
Estella Heights / The EstellaAn Phú, District 2 (Thu Duc City)Allowed (Dogs/cats registered, under 15kg)Private internal dog park & lawnResident & Service Elevators9.6 / 10
City GardenBình Thạnh (D1 Fringe)Allowed (Mandatory registration)Large central grass lawns & gardensDedicated Service Elevator (Thang Hàng)9.3 / 10
Scenic Valley & MidtownPhú Mỹ Hưng, District 7Allowed (Leashed/muzzled in lobbies)Crescent Park & scenic canal beltsService Elevators Required9.0 / 10
Masteri An Phú / Masteri Thảo ĐiềnThảo Điền, District 2Allowed (Dogs/cats under 12kg)River promenade access nearbyMandatory Service Elevator8.5 / 10
Sunwah PearlBình Thạnh (Riverfront)Allowed (Small pets under 10kg)Saigon River waterfront promenadeService Elevator for Large Dogs8.2 / 10
Empire CityThủ Thiêm, District 2Case-by-Case (Tower specific)Central green park & boardwalkDedicated Freight Elevator7.8 / 10
Vinhomes Central ParkBình Thạnh DistrictHighly Restricted (Varies by tower)Central 14ha park (Perimeter paths only)Strictly Monitored6.2 / 10
Vinhomes Golden River (Ba Son)District 1 CBDProhibited (Strict Ban)Courtyards monitored by securityNo Pets Permitted in Common Areas2.0 / 10

2. Essential Pet Lease Addendum Clauses & Deposit Protections

Never rely on informal messaging app promises from rental brokers. To safeguard your tenancy and security deposit, attach an explicit Pet Addendum (Phụ lục nuôi thú cưng) to your standard bilingual lease agreement.

Addendum Protection ClauseRecommended Contract LanguageExpat Tenant BenefitLandlord Security Benefit
Pet Identification ClauseState pet species, breed, age, color, weight, and microchip number.Prevents landlord eviction based on alleged animal size changes.Assures owner no unauthorized additional animals are housed.
Dedicated Pet DepositCap pet damage deposit at 0.5 to 1 month rent (Tiền cọc nuôi thú cưng).Isolates pet risk from general security deposit.Funds upholstery, drapery, or wooden floor scratch repairs.
Deep Cleaning CovenantAgree to furnish professional steam-cleaning receipt at checkout ($50–$100).Guarantees full deposit return if sanitization standard is met.Ensures odor-free, allergen-free unit for subsequent tenants.
Building Bylaw Escape ClausePermit 30-day penalty-free exit if Ban Quản Lý alters pet charter mid-lease.Protects deposit if condo management imposes sudden bans.Gives landlord clear notice if building bylaws shift.
"
In Vietnam, nearly 60% of pet deposit deductions stem from claw damage on engineered wooden floors and pet hair in air conditioner blower wheels. Getting a professional AC chemical wash and upholstery cleaning before your final handover walkthrough eliminates 90% of landlord deposit disputes.

3. Daily Building Management (Ban Quản Lý) Protocols

Living in high-rise towers in Saigon involves adhering to daily property management rules:

  1. Rabies Immunization Documentation: Upon move-in, submit your pet’s veterinary health booklet showing current Rabies (Bệnh Dại) and core vaccinations (DHPP for dogs, FVRCP for cats) to the Ban Quản Lý reception desk.
  2. Freight / Service Elevator (Thang Hàng): Many luxury high-rises require pets to travel exclusively in service elevators to accommodate residents with severe allergies or phobias.
  3. Noise & Barking Violations: Under Decree 144/2021/ND-CP and building bylaws, persistent barking causing neighborhood disturbance during quiet hours (10:00 PM to 6:00 AM) can trigger administrative fines from 500,000 to 2,000,000 VND billed directly to your monthly apartment maintenance invoice.
  4. Waste Management: Always carry waste bags. Leaving animal waste in common gardens or elevators results in immediate security camera identification and building management penalties.

4. Balcony Safety Netting & Tropical Climate Care

Saigon’s physical environment presents distinct climate and architectural factors for pet health:

Balcony Safety Netting (Lưới An Toàn)

High-rise balconies and open laundry loggias in towers like Masteri, Sunwah, or Scenic Valley pose severe fall hazards (“high-rise syndrome”) for curious cats and small dogs.

  • Installation: Professional invisible stainless steel tension netting (Lưới an toàn ban công) can be installed for 300,000 to 500,000 VND ($12–$20 USD) per balcony.
  • Management Approval: Invisible netting is approved by most building management boards because it does not obstruct building facade aesthetics.

Tropical Heat & EVN Electricity Management

During Saigon’s hot dry season (March to May), daytime temperatures regularly exceed 36°C (97°F). Long-haired breeds (Golden Retrievers, French Bulldogs, Persian cats) require continuous air conditioning to prevent heatstroke.

  • Power Costs: Running an inverter air conditioner 24/7 for pets adds approximately 250 to 350 kWh per month, costing 800,000 to 1,400,000 VND ($32–$56 USD/month) under official EVN 6-Tier Residential Tariffs.

5. 24/7 International Veterinary Hospitals in Saigon

Access to rapid, multilingual veterinary healthcare is essential for expatriate pet owners. Here is the verified 2026 directory of international veterinary clinics in Ho Chi Minh City:

Clinic / Hospital NamePrimary LocationLanguages Spoken24/7 Emergency CareRelocation & Titre TestingContact & Emergency
Animal Doctors International (ADI)Thảo Điền, District 2English, French, VietnameseYes (24/7 ICU & Surgeon)Full International Export/Import028 6260 3980 / D2 Clinic
Sasaki Animal HospitalThảo Điền, District 2Japanese, English, VietnameseYes (On-call emergency)Japanese Microchip & Health Certs028 3744 2658
PetPro Veterinary HospitalDistrict 7 & Tân BìnhEnglish, VietnameseYes (24/7 In-patient ICU)Diagnostic Imaging, Orthopedics028 3844 5328
Saigon Pet HospitalThảo Điền, District 2English, French, VietnameseYes (24/7 Emergency triage)Surgical Suite & Blood Bank028 3519 4182
New Pet HospitalDistrict 1 (Đa Kao)English, VietnameseYes (24/7 Central access)Dental, Soft Tissue Surgery028 6269 3939

6. Police Temporary Residence (Tạm Trú) Compliance

When registering your lease with the local Ward Police (Công an Phường) under statutory Temporary Residence Tam Tru Guidelines, declare all co-habitants accurately. While pets are not recorded on the national immigration database, ensuring your rental contract is legally registered protects you from retaliatory landlord actions during pet noise or maintenance disputes.

Frequently Asked Questions

Are pets legally permitted in Vietnamese residential condominiums?

Under Article 3 of the 2023 Law on Housing, raising livestock in residential condos is prohibited, but domestic pets (dogs, cats) are governed by individual building management bylaws (Nội quy tòa nhà). Written landlord consent and building management board (Ban Quản Lý) registration are legally required.

Do landlords in Saigon require a separate pet deposit?

Yes, landlords in Saigon standardly request an additional 0.5 to 1-month pet security deposit or an explicit non-refundable move-out deep cleaning covenant ($50–$100 USD) to remediate upholstery, air filters, and sanitization upon lease termination.

Which neighborhoods in Ho Chi Minh City have the best pet amenities?

Thao Dien (District 2 / Thu Duc City) and Phu My Hung (District 7) offer the best pet amenities, featuring walkable sidewalks, private dog runs, pet-friendly cafes, and 24/7 international animal hospitals (Animal Doctors International, Sasaki, PetPro).
